BROWN v. STATE

No. 98-3051.

741 So.2d 1242 (1999)

Normando R. BROWN, Appellant, v. STATE of Florida, Appellee.

District Court of Appeal of Florida, First District.

October 4, 1999.


Attorney(s) appearing for the Case

Nancy A. Daniels, Public Defender; Robert Friedman, Assistant Public Defender, Tallahassee, for Appellant.

Robert A. Butterworth, Attorney General; Veronica S. McCrackin, Assistant Attorney General; Denise O. Simpson, Assistant Attorney General, Tallahassee, for Appellee.


ON MOTION FOR REHEARING

PER CURIAM.

The state seeks rehearing of our opinion in Brown v. State, 24 Fla. L. Weekly D1781 (Fla. 1st DCA July 27, 1999). We grant rehearing, withdraw our opinion and substitute the following therefor.
